The industry stopped training juniors and has not said what replaces it

Entry-level developer hiring is down 67% since 2022, and AI is best at exactly the tasks that used to be a junior's training ground. Nobody has explained where the next seniors come from.

The number that should worry the industry more than it does: entry-level developer hiring is down 67% since 2022, with employment for developers aged 22 to 25 down nearly 20% since late 2022.

The mechanism is not mysterious, and that is what makes it awkward. AI coding tools are unusually good at exactly the work that used to be a junior engineer's training ground — boilerplate, small well-specified bug fixes, documentation, test scaffolding. Companies that once hired five juniors now hire two mid-level engineers with AI tools.

On a one-year view that is straightforwardly efficient. On a five-year view somebody has to explain where mid-level engineers come from.

Why those tasks existed

Here is the part that gets lost when the work is framed as low-value.

Nobody ever assigned a junior a CRUD endpoint because the CRUD endpoint was hard. They assigned it because writing it teaches you where the codebase keeps things, what the team's conventions are, how the review process works, what breaks in production and why, and — most importantly — how to tell a good solution from one that merely runs.

The output was almost worthless. The learning was the point. It was an apprenticeship with a deliverable attached, and the deliverable was the excuse.

When you automate the deliverable, you do not automate the learning. You remove the occasion for it.

The judgement problem

This connects to something visible in the productivity research: AI tools help most in clean codebases with good tests, and their output requires evaluation.

Evaluation is a senior skill. Recognising that generated code is plausible but subtly wrong, that it handles the happy path and ignores the concurrent case, that it has quietly introduced an N+1 query — that judgement was built by writing bad versions of the same thing and having someone explain why they were bad.

So the industry has built a tool whose value depends on senior judgement, and paid for it by removing the pipeline that produces senior judgement. That is a coherent short-term trade and an obviously incoherent long-term one.

Where juniors still get hired

The pattern is informative. Enterprises, financial institutions, defence contractors and healthcare technology firms still hire juniors consistently, because their codebases and compliance requirements demand human judgement in places automation cannot reach.

In other words, the organisations that still train people are the ones where the work is too consequential to hand over. That is a slightly damning observation about everyone else.

The expectations have also shifted. Juniors are now expected to arrive "pre-trained" on skills that used to be taught on the job, fluent with AI tooling and able to ship complete features. Which is to say: the industry has stopped offering apprenticeships and started requiring that candidates have already completed one.

What a small studio can actually do

I am not going to pretend a small team can fix a structural problem. But the incentives here are less one-sided than they look.

Hiring a junior in 2026 is cheaper in one respect than it was: a motivated junior with good tooling reaches useful output faster than they did five years ago. The tools that removed the training tasks also compress the ramp.

What has to change is what you assign. The old model — give them the simple ticket — no longer transfers much, because the simple ticket is now a prompt. The version that works is to put them on real work with a senior reviewing closely, and make the review the teaching. That is more expensive in senior attention, which is precisely why fewer firms do it.

The other thing worth saying plainly is that a studio which trains people ends up with engineers who understand its systems deeply, and that is not a charitable act. It is the cheapest way to get senior engineers who are also a good fit, in a market where hiring them directly is expensive and uncertain.

The open question

Nobody knows how this resolves. It is possible that the definition of "junior" shifts, that the first two years become about system design and evaluation rather than implementation, and the pipeline reconstitutes in a different shape.

It is also possible that a cohort simply does not get trained, and in seven years there is a visible shortage of people who can do the judgement work that the tools require.

What is not credible is the position that this is fine and requires no thought. Every senior engineer currently reviewing AI output learned to do it by doing the work that AI now does. That was not free, and it has not been replaced with anything.
